Restless Legs Syndrome
A neurological disorder characterized by an irresistible urge to move the legs, typically accompanied by uncomfortable or unpleasant sensations, often worsening during periods of inactivity.
Seasonal Affective Disorder
A type of depression related to changes in seasons, beginning and ending at about the same times every year, often in winter.
